Introduction to Skin Whitening Treatment in Dubai

Skin whitening treatment, also known as skin lightening or bleaching, is a cosmetic procedure that aims to lighten the skin tone and reduce the appearance of dark spots, blemishes, and discoloration. These treatments work by inhibiting the production of melanin, the pigment that gives skin its color.

Top Skin Whitening Treatments in Dubai

Laser Skin Whitening

Laser skin whitening is a popular treatment that uses laser technology to target and break down melanin deposits in the skin. This treatment is effective in reducing the appearance of dark spots, acne scars, and sun damage. It is a non-invasive procedure that requires little to no downtime.

Chemical Peels

Chemical peels are another effective skin whitening treatment that involves applying a chemical solution to the skin to exfoliate the outer layer. This helps to remove dead skin cells and promote the growth of new, lighter skin cells. Chemical peels can improve the appearance of pigmentation issues, acne scars, and dull skin.

Glutathione Injections

Glutathione injections are a popular skin whitening treatment in Dubai. Glutathione is an antioxidant that is naturally produced in the body and has been found to have skin-lightening properties. These injections are administered intravenously and are believed to work by inhibiting the production of melanin.

Cost Comparison of Different Treatments

The cost of skin whitening treatments in Dubai can vary depending on the type of treatment, the number of sessions required, and the clinic you choose. Laser skin whitening typically costs between AED 1000 to AED 3000 per session, while chemical peels can range from AED 500 to AED 1500 per session. Glutathione injections are generally more expensive, with prices starting from AED 2000 per session.
